iPhone 5 unveiling 10/4

WHAT’S APPLE COOKING UP? Apple plans to unveil the iPhone 5 during an event scheduled for next Tuesday morning (10/4) at its Cupertino HQ—the first to be hosted by new CEO Tim Cook. The company sent out invitations—though not to us—with the heading “Let’s talk iPhone,” along with several screen icons. The new iPhone is rumored to boast a voice activation tool that lets users aurally send text messages, make appointments and take notes. Piper Jaffray analyst Gene Munster said in a note Tuesday that Apple “will likely announce a redesigned iPhone 5 with a larger screen and thinner form-factor for $199/$299, and may drop the iPhone 4 to $99, possibly with slightly upgraded components and a new name, iPhone 4S.” (9/29a)
